The Good Samaritan Health System requires
all Vendor Representatives doing business with us to apply for privileges and be
credentialed on an annual basis as well as adhere to the Good Samaritan Vendor
Program.
WHY DO WE REQUIRE VENDORS TO
OBTAIN PRIVILEGES?
All Vendor Representatives calling on the health
system to provide goods or services to the Good Samaritan Health System must be credentialed. The
credentialing process is a means to improve communication between vendors and Good Samaritan, increase vendor understanding of compliance with Good Samaritan policies and
procedures and to facilitate smooth, efficient business transactions. Good Samaritan
will not conduct business with vendors or companies that fail to meet minimum
certification standards. We require that all Vendor Representatives complete
certification requirements prior to meeting with staff in any Departments
(including off-site locations). Without this privilege, you will not be
permitted to gain access to departments where you conduct business.

HOW DO I BECOME AN APPROVED VENDOR AND BE PLACED ON YOUR VENDOR LIST?
Good Samaritan Health System does not have an “approved vendor” list. If you are interested in doing business with Good Samaritan, submit to the attention of the Director of Materials Management a short summary description of the goods and/or services that your company provides as well as contact information for your company. This information can be sent by fax to 717-270-7840 or by U.S. mail to Director – Materials Management, GSH Quentin Road Center, 1503 Quentin Road, Lebanon, PA 17042.
